    Geneva D.

    I'm so glad this strip of Campus Drive is being developed and adding more eateries. This definitely isn't the only ramen shop in the neighborhood, but it probably has some of the most convenient parking which makes it ideal. Ambiance: I stopped in a Friday evening about an hour before they closed at 9:30p. The restaurant itself is pretty large for the area with about 8 tables to seat 4-6. As soon as you enter, you find 2 kiosks for order. There's an open concept kitchen so you can see and smell the food being prepared as you wait. Service: I didn't dine in, so I can't speak to the sit down experience. Ordering from the kiosks was pretty straight forward-- just select what you like, pay, and you get a text message when your food is ready. There were people that walked in after me for dine in that were confused if it was self-seating or if they should wait for a server. I'm deducting 1 start because when you pay at the kiosk they tack on a "convenience fee" that's coupled with tax. I find that a little unfair since there isn't an actual person to place a to-go order with. Food: I ordered the Aka Oni Karaka. It took about 15 minutes to prepare. The ramen broth was packaged separately as maintain it's heat for the 20 min drive home. Flavor wise-- it was tasty and I'll definitely order it again. It was just spicy enough for you to feel the kick without your mouth being fire. The perfect kind of ramen for a sick day or to satisfy a craving. 4/5

    Victoria S.

    This ramen joint is located near a parking garage (free for retail establishments in that same strip). The interior is minimalist and spacious. The menus are accessed by scanning the QR code at each table. Orders are placed at the touchscreen displays near the front door. Everything is seamless and convenient. If any questions arise servers are around to answer in person. They have several solid ramen choices, along with rice bowls, curry and traditional appetizers (squid, gyoza, takoyaki, ect) all reasonably priced. I got the raku motoaji, which was their non-spicy vegan ramen. It came with curly noodles in a mild vegetable broth, 2 slabs of pan-fried tofu, seaweed, sprouts, bamboo shoots, shredded cabbage, tomato slice, asparagus and scallions. Compared to other vegan ramen bowls from other places this one was much lighter and less salty. The broth had a much cleaner taste. My companion liked his nirvana aka (which was essentially my choice but with spicy broth). Servers came by often to fill water and were very courteous and professional.

    Ask the Community - Onikama Ramen Bar

    Is there parking near the restaurant, that a wheelchair can reach?

    There is a free garage & leaving the garage is a ramp to take you directly into the restaurant
